How to Clean Dropper Bottles Yourself: A Simple 4-Step Guide Aug 16 , 2025
Cleaning cosmetic glass dropper bottles properly is key to keeping your serums, essential oils, and liquids free from contamination. Follow this quick 4-step process to ensure they’re spotless and safe for reuse.
First, disassemble the glass dropper bottle—separate the rubber bulb, glass pipette, and bottle itself. Fill a bowl with warm (not hot) water and let all parts soak for 10–15 minutes. This loosens residue, oils, or dried liquids clinging to the surfaces, making them easier to clean.
Next, disinfect with rubbing alcohol (70% isopropyl works best). Either submerge all components in alcohol for 5 minutes, or pour alcohol into the bottle and squeeze the bulb repeatedly to flush the tube thoroughly. Alcohol effectively kills bacteria and breaks down tough, stubborn grime that plain water would likely leave behind.
After alcohol treatment, rinse all components with warm water to remove any alcohol residue. Then, air-dry them completely on a clean towel—laying them upside down helps speed up drying and prevents moisture buildup, which can lead to mold.
For an extra layer of sanitization, use an infrared ozone sterilizer. Place the dry parts inside, run the machine according to its instructions (usually 10–20 minutes), and let it complete the cycle. Ozone and infrared light work together to eliminate even the tiniest pathogens, ensuring your dropper bottles are germ-free and ready for their next use.
This straightforward routine keeps your dropper bottles in top shape, protecting your products and extending the life of your containers.
